Government expenditure on secondary education, US$ in Barbados
Barbados: Government expenditure on secondary education, US$ was 76.71 millions in 2023. ▲ Rising
Government expenditure on secondary education, US$ in Barbados, 1971–2023
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in millions.
Analysis
The most recent figure for government expenditure on secondary education, us$ in Barbados is 76.71 millions, measured in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 8.1% on the previous year and up 30.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, government expenditure on secondary education, us$ in Barbados peaked at 80.13 millions in 2010 and was at its lowest, 3.49 millions, in 1971.
That places Barbados 118th out of 153 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 27 years of available data.
